Webmasters Say Yahoo's "Search Pad" is A Scrapper Tool!
February 6th, 2009 | RSS Feed
Yesterday, Yahoo! came out with its new “Search Pad” feature that holds an astonishing similarity with Google's disposed Notepad tool! But it seems that the webmasters are dejected and crestfallen as most of them think that it is a complete scrapper tool that is used to capture their websites. Some of them are ready to block this tool completely and others think that it is not more than just a glorified scraping tool! The response is not positive at all.
